Abstract

The utility model discloses a ceiling type air conditioner with natural water drainage, which comprises an air box body, an evaporator, a fan and an air blast/return panel. A fan chamber, an air return chamber and an air blast chamber are arranged inside the air box body; the air blast port and the air return port of the air blast/return panel are communicated with the air blast chamber and the air return chamber respectively, the fan is arranged inside the fan chamber, the evaporator is arranged between the air draft side of the fan chamber and the air blast chamber, and the induced draft side of the fan chamber is communicated with the air return port; and a water collection tray is arranged at the lower part of the evaporator and is provided with a drainage pipe thereon.

Background technology
At present, air-conditioning smallpox machine is owing to be subjected to the restriction of its height, and the evaporimeter installation site is extremely low, because evaporimeter can condense in the course of the work a large amount of condensed waters is arranged, for condensed water is discharged, parts such as draining pump, level sensor need be set, there is following defective in this structure:
1, parts such as draining pump, level sensor are set, have improved the production cost of equipment, control is complicated;
2, because draining pump and level sensor are electric component, and condensed water can cause tangible influence to the performance and the life-span of electric component, so the draining fault appears in traditional air-conditioning smallpox machine easily, reliability is low.
